> P25 stuff from San Francisco
> Here is what I heard. Hope this is useful.
> Lawrence Livermore system
> NAC=3B0 for the Trunk system
> NAC=3B9 site 1.9 channel is 4-1971 407.1875MHz
> TG=120 RID=705xxx enc
> TG=120 RID=705xxx enc
> Looks like this site has 5 transmitters
